package systemd import ( "bufio" "bytes" "context" "errors" "fmt" "os/exec" "path/filepath" "strings" ) const ( loadStateProperty = "LoadState" activeStateProperty = "ActiveState" subStateProperty = "SubState" loadedState = "loaded" notFoundState = "not-found" ) // Systemctl invokes one exact systemctl executable directly, never through a shell. type Systemctl struct { executable string } // NewSystemctl requires the absolute executable path supplied by local daemon configuration. func NewSystemctl(executable string) (*Systemctl, error) { if !filepath.IsAbs(executable) { return nil, errors.New("systemctl executable path must be absolute") } return &Systemctl{executable: executable}, nil } func (s *Systemctl) Inspect(ctx context.Context, unitName string) (Unit, error) { if err := validateUnitName(unitName); err != nil { return Unit{}, err } command := exec.CommandContext(ctx, s.executable, "show", "--no-pager", "--property="+loadStateProperty, "--property="+activeStateProperty, "--property="+subStateProperty, "--", unitName, ) output, err := command.CombinedOutput() if err != nil { return Unit{}, commandError("inspect systemd unit "+unitName, output, err) } unit, err := parseUnitProperties(unitName, output) if err != nil { return Unit{}, err } if unit.LoadState == notFoundState { return Unit{}, fmt.Errorf("inspect systemd unit %s: %w", unitName, ErrUnitNotFound) } if unit.LoadState != loadedState { return Unit{}, fmt.Errorf("systemd unit %s has unsupported load state %q", unitName, unit.LoadState) } return unit, nil } func (s *Systemctl) Start(ctx context.Context, unitName string) error { return s.changeState(ctx, "start", unitName) } func (s *Systemctl) Stop(ctx context.Context, unitName string) error { return s.changeState(ctx, "stop", unitName) } func (s *Systemctl) changeState(ctx context.Context, action, unitName string) error { if err := validateUnitName(unitName); err != nil { return err } output, err := exec.CommandContext(ctx, s.executable, action, "--", unitName).CombinedOutput() if err != nil { return commandError(action+" systemd unit "+unitName, output, err) } return nil } func parseUnitProperties(unitName string, output []byte) (Unit, error) { values := make(map[string]string, 3) scanner := bufio.NewScanner(bytes.NewReader(output)) for scanner.Scan() { line := scanner.Text() key, value, found := strings.Cut(line, "=") if !found { return Unit{}, fmt.Errorf("decode systemd unit %s property line %q", unitName, line) } switch key { case loadStateProperty, activeStateProperty, subStateProperty: if _, duplicate := values[key]; duplicate { return Unit{}, fmt.Errorf("decode systemd unit %s duplicate property %s", unitName, key) } values[key] = value default: return Unit{}, fmt.Errorf("decode systemd unit %s unexpected property %q", unitName, key) } } if err := scanner.Err(); err != nil { return Unit{}, fmt.Errorf("decode systemd unit %s properties: %w", unitName, err) } for _, key := range []string{loadStateProperty, activeStateProperty, subStateProperty} { if _, found := values[key]; !found { return Unit{}, fmt.Errorf("decode systemd unit %s missing property %s", unitName, key) } } return Unit{ Name: unitName, LoadState: values[loadStateProperty], ActiveState: values[activeStateProperty], SubState: values[subStateProperty], }, nil } func validateUnitName(unitName string) error { if unitName == "" || strings.TrimSpace(unitName) != unitName { return errors.New("exact systemd unit name is required") } return nil } func commandError(action string, output []byte, err error) error { detail := strings.TrimSpace(string(output)) if detail == "" { return fmt.Errorf("%s: %w", action, err) } return fmt.Errorf("%s: %w: %s", action, err, detail) } var _ Manager = (*Systemctl)(nil)
